Key Nutrients
Per 33.0g servingLarge apricots contains 18.0g of carbs, 13.0g of sugar, 1.0g of protein, 0.0g of fat, and 2.0g of fiber per 33.0g serving. These nutrients directly impact blood sugar levels and overall nutritional value.

Large Apricots contains 54.6g carbs, 39.4g sugars, 6.1g fiber, and 3.0g protein per 100g.
This food has a moderate blood sugar impact and can be included with portion control. Always consult with your healthcare provider about foods that fit your individual dietary needs.
Consider the nutritional profile and blood sugar impact when incorporating Large Apricots into your meals. Pair higher-impact foods with protein and fiber for better blood sugar control.
